Lowest-Fee Methods
When it comes to sending money from Australia to China, several options exist, each with its own pros and cons. Traditional “Big Four” banks – CBA, ANZ, NAB, and Westpac – often charge substantial fees for international transfers, typically ranging from AUD 25 to AUD 40 per transaction, plus potentially unfavourable exchange rates. Wire transfers (SWIFT) can be even more expensive, with fees potentially exceeding AUD 50, and transfer times often taking 2-3 business days. Fintech apps, including Panda Remit, generally offer lower fees and faster processing times.
For example, sending AUD 1,000 via a traditional bank might result in fees of AUD 30-40 and a less competitive exchange rate, delivering approximately CNY 4,800 to the recipient. A wire transfer of AUD 5,000 could incur fees of AUD 50-60, resulting in around CNY 23,500. Fastest Methods
Speed is often a critical factor, especially when sending money for urgent needs or special occasions. Traditional Australian banks typically take 2-3 business days to process international transfers via SWIFT, meaning your recipient won’t receive the funds immediately. Fintech apps, on the other hand, offer significantly faster transfer times.
